Color and Material One of the first decisions I had to make was the color of the carpet. I knew I wanted to keep the drawing room neutral and elegant, so I gravitated toward soft shades of beige, grey, and taupe. These colors not only aligned with modern design trends but also allowed me to pair the carpet with various furniture and decor styles. After much thought, I chose a light grey tone for the carpet, which created an airy, spacious feel while still adding warmth.
Material was another important consideration. Given the temperature fluctuations in Dubai, I wanted a carpet that would offer insulation while still being breathable. After much research, I opted for a wool blend. Wool is a natural fiber known for its luxurious feel, durability, and natural stain resistance—an essential feature for a high-traffic area like the drawing room. It also has excellent heat-regulating properties, making it perfect for both the warm Dubai climate and cooler indoor temperatures.
Pile Height and Texture The next factor that influenced my decision was the texture of the carpet. Carpets with a high pile are often softer and more comfortable, but they can be harder to clean. On the other hand, low-pile carpets tend to be more durable and easier to maintain. For my drawing room, I opted for a medium-pile carpet that strikes the perfect balance between softness and practicality. The subtle texture added a sophisticated touch to the room without overwhelming the space.

Ongoing Care and Maintenance
One of my main concerns when choosing a wall-to-wall carpet was how to maintain it in a busy home. However, I quickly discovered that wool-blend carpets are relatively easy to care for. Regular vacuuming ensures that dirt and dust don’t accumulate, and occasional professional cleaning keeps the carpet looking as good as new.
Another advantage of wool is its natural stain resistance. Despite the occasional spill or foot traffic, the carpet has held up beautifully, retaining its color and texture. I also invested in carpet protectors for high-traffic areas, which helped maintain the carpet's integrity over time.
